>Subject: [PATCH] virtio_balloon: fix shrinker count
>
>Instead of multiplying by page order, virtio balloon divided by page
>order. The result is that it can return 0 if there are a bit less
>than MAX_ORDER - 1 pages in use, and then shrinker scan won't be called.

I think that the fixes tag should be pointing to 86a559787e6f
("virtio-balloon: VIRTIO_BALLOON_F_FREE_PAGE_HINT"), and this commit
isn't needed on 4.19.
